What is a Marketing Funnel?
A marketing funnel is a tactical structure used to imagine and assist the consumer journey from initial awareness to final purchase, classifying customers into distinct phases: the top of the funnel (ToFu), middle of the funnel (MoFu), and bottom of the funnel (BoFu). This framework helps in comprehending consumer experience at each phase.
This design makes it possible for services to comprehend how to engage customers through targeted marketing methods at each stage, facilitating a seamless shift toward sales conversion and client relationships. How to Determine the Success of Your Marketing Funnel
Determining the success of a marketing funnel is important for comprehending its effectiveness and recognizing areas for improvement. This can be achieved through using different crucial efficiency indicators (KPIs), including conversion rates, client life time worth, and return on investment.
By examining these metrics, services can evaluate the performance of each phase of the funnel in interesting and converting leads. This examination helps with data-driven decision-making, eventually enhancing marketing methods and enhancing future projects.
Conversion Rates
Conversion rates function as an important metric for evaluating the effectiveness of a marketing funnel, as they reflect the portion of leads that effectively advance from one phase to the next, ultimately resulting in a purchase. High conversion rates suggest that marketing techniques effectively engage potential customers and satisfy their requirements, whereas low rates might reveal locations in the funnel that need improvement.
To precisely calculate conversion rates at each phase, it is very important to compare the total variety of visitors or leads at the beginning of the funnel with those who successfully advance through the subsequent stages.
Define each stage: awareness, factor to consider, and decision-making.
Track the number of leads going into each phase and compare these figures to those that progress even more.
Utilize tools such as Google Analytics to acquire detailed insights.
Techniques for improvement consist of:
A/B testing various versions of landing pages to recognize which aspects resonate most effectively.
Enhancing landing pages by improving user experience and clarity, thus helping with the shift from results in clients.
Refining messaging to better deal with the discomfort points of the target market, making sure that communication is both clear and engaging.
By executing these techniques, services can improve their conversion rates and ultimately drive increased revenue.

Return on Investment
Roi (ROI) is an important metric for assessing the monetary success of a marketing funnel, as it suggests the efficiency of marketing expenses in creating profit. By examining ROI, businesses can figure out which marketing channels and methods offer the greatest returns, thus enhancing resource allowance and notifying future marketing choices.
To accurately determine ROI, organizations commonly use the formula: ROI = (Net Revenue/ Cost of Financial Investment) x 100%. This formula enables online marketers to measure the value generated from their campaigns relative to the costs incurred.
For example, if a company introduces a social networks project with an expense of $10,000 that results in $50,000 in sales, the ROI would be 400%.
